Also an interesting titbit -\" In Sikhism, the number 13 is considered a special number since 13 is tera in Punjabi, which also means \" yours\" (as in, \" I am yours, O Lord\" ). The legend goes that when Guru Nanak Dev was taking stock of items as part of his employment with a village merchant, he counted from 1 to 13 (in Punjabi) as one does normally and thereafter he would just repeat \" tera\" , since all items were God' s creation. The merchant confronted Guru Nanak about this, but found everything to be in order after the inventory was checked. April 13 also usually turns out to be Vaisakhi every year, which is the Sikh New Year and the major Sikh Holiday.\"
